In this episode, I share a quote that’s been sitting with me for over two years. A quote that stopped me in my tracks the moment I first read it:

“Healing also means taking an honest look at the role you play in your own suffering.”

That one sentence cracked something open in me. Not because it was easy to hear, but because it was undeniably true.

This isn’t about blame or shame. It’s about freedom. Ownership. Liberation. It’s about asking bold, honest questions like:

“Is this belief actually true?”

“Who told me this about myself?”

“And do I still want to carry that story?”

I reflect on the years I spent performing different versions of myself. Trying to be the daughter, wife, woman, and friend that others expected me to be, all while feeling completely misaligned inside. I share about the retreat that changed everything for me in 2012, when I began asking the question:

“Who does God say that I am?”

That question became the doorway to a year of deep internal reckoning and the beginning of becoming my true self.

This conversation is raw and real. I talk about trauma, limiting beliefs, the lies we absorb from culture and childhood, and how I started breaking free by choosing awareness and responsibility.
